Victory Smokin' Oats Porter
5.8% abv. Downingtown, PA
From the brewer: the aroma of beechwood smoked malts lead you to the chocolate edge of dark roasted malts contributing to the complexity of this dark ale.

Fat Head's The Antagonizer
8.5% abv 18 ibu
From the brewer: Historically brewed as liquid bread by and for fasting monks, this creamy Doppelbock is a strong lager with a rich malty flavor, toasty aroma and ruby hue.

Penn Brewery Penn Weizen
This one was very good, a cloudy, unfiltered pint hit the spot. Pittsburgh still sucks though.
From the brewer: Bavarian style wheat beer, 5% abv.
This authentic wheat beer, brewed in southern German tradition, won the silver medal in 1997 and the gold medal at the 2000 Great American Beer Festival in Denver, Colorado. Penn Weizen is top-fermented, cask conditioned, and very effervescent with a slight hint of tangy clove flavor.
